Produktivitas adalah kunci kesuksesan seorang developer. Dengan tools yang tepat, pekerjaan bisa dilakukan lebih cepat, lebih efisien, dan dengan hasil yang lebih baik. Berikut adalah 10 tools gratis yang wajib dicoba oleh developer untuk meningkatkan produktivitas mereka.
1. Visual Studio Code (VS Code)
VS Code adalah text editor gratis dari Microsoft yang ringan, fleksibel, dan mendukung berbagai bahasa pemrograman. Dengan ekosistem ekstensi yang luas, VS Code menjadi pilihan utama banyak developer.
Fitur utama:
IntelliSense untuk melengkapi kode secara otomatis.
Debugging langsung di editor.
Ekstensi seperti Prettier, ESLint, dan GitLens.
2. GitHub
GitHub adalah platform hosting kode berbasis cloud yang mendukung pengelolaan proyek dengan Git. Developer dapat berkolaborasi, melacak perubahan, dan menyimpan repositori secara gratis.
Fitur utama:
Repositori pribadi tanpa batas.
Tools kolaborasi seperti pull request dan issue tracking.
GitHub Actions untuk otomatisasi.
3. Postman
Postman memudahkan developer untuk menguji dan mendokumentasikan API. Tool ini memungkinkan pengujian endpoint API dengan cepat dan mudah.
Fitur utama:
Pengujian API manual dan otomatis.
Sinkronisasi koleksi API dengan tim.
Dukungan untuk berbagai metode HTTP.
4. Docker
Docker memungkinkan developer untuk membuat, mengelola, dan menjalankan aplikasi dalam lingkungan yang terisolasi. Ini sangat berguna untuk memastikan aplikasi berjalan dengan konsisten di berbagai lingkungan.
Fitur utama:
Containerization untuk memisahkan aplikasi.
Image Docker gratis di Docker Hub.
Mendukung CI/CD.
5. Notion
Notion adalah alat serbaguna untuk mencatat, mengelola proyek, dan berkolaborasi dengan tim. Developer dapat menggunakannya untuk mendokumentasikan proyek atau membuat to-do list.
Fitur utama:
Template untuk catatan pengembangan.
Integrasi dengan berbagai aplikasi.
Manajemen tugas berbasis kanban.
6. Trello
Trello adalah alat manajemen proyek berbasis papan kanban. Tool ini cocok untuk melacak tugas harian atau proyek besar.
Fitur utama:
Antarmuka sederhana dan intuitif.
Kustomisasi papan proyek.
Integrasi dengan Slack dan Google Drive.
7. Figma
Figma adalah alat desain berbasis cloud untuk prototyping dan kolaborasi. Tool ini sering digunakan oleh developer front-end untuk memvisualisasikan UI/UX.
Fitur utama:
Desain real-time bersama tim.
Kompatibilitas lintas platform.
Library desain yang dapat digunakan ulang.
8. Grammarly
Grammarly membantu developer untuk menulis dokumentasi, email, atau komentar kode tanpa kesalahan tata bahasa. Tool ini juga memiliki ekstensi untuk browser dan aplikasi desktop.
Fitur utama:
Koreksi tata bahasa secara otomatis.
Saran penulisan profesional.
Analisis nada untuk tulisan.
9. Insomnia
Alternatif ringan untuk Postman, Insomnia adalah tool untuk pengujian API. Dengan antarmuka yang sederhana, developer dapat mengelola dan menguji endpoint dengan mudah.
Fitur utama:
Dukungan untuk GraphQL dan REST API.
Organisasi permintaan API.
Open-source dengan komunitas yang aktif.
10. Tabnine
Tabnine adalah asisten AI untuk melengkapi kode secara otomatis. Tool ini mendukung berbagai bahasa pemrograman dan dapat diintegrasikan dengan editor seperti VS Code.
Fitur utama:
Saran kode berbasis AI.
Integrasi dengan editor populer.
Mendukung bahasa seperti Python, JavaScript, dan lainnya.
0 Response to "10 Tools Gratis untuk Meningkatkan Produktivitas Developer"
Posting Komentar